Description

Rectangular tin box w/ hinged lid, painted purple w/ green and violet floral design and gilt trim.

Inscription

Painted on lid: ""Louis Sherry/ New York/ PARIS/ 1 lb. NET WEIGHT."" Also engraved on box bottom: ""CANCO""
